You can only talk with primary engine ecu and trans but not the secondary engine ecu?

Have you tried just selecting Aston icon only and not the OBD icon. 07E8 is engine and 07E9 is trans (assuming 07EE is secondary ecu), if foxwell uses a default setting because of generic obd icon selection, then you won't be able to communicate with secondary ecu.

Hi Irish, thanks for helping. When selecting the Aston icon, I can communicate with any module. In that section, it identifies them as V12 bank 1 and bank 2, and the trans is identified separately. Nonetheless, I don't end up with not being able to communicate there, and it seems I can read from everything, though I am not able to get the same amount of "live data" that I could get when selecting the OBD-II icon. My worry in all of this was that I wouldn't be able to retrieve useful live data from that missing module.
